Assistant Professor

Areas of interest include dynamic and synoptic meteorology and geophysical/environmental fluid dynamics, with a view towards describing and understanding flows on scales ranging from 10s of meters to 1000s of kilometers. The ultimate goal of these studies is to bridge the gap between observations and theory, and the approach taken is to combine data from observations with theoretical analysis and numerical simulations using both simple models on single-processor workstations and highly complex models on massively parallel machines. Current research projects include: the breakdown of dynamical balance and the generation of inertia–gravity waves associated with fronts and jets in the upper troposphere; the dynamics of upper-tropospheric precursors to extratropical cyclogenesis; coupled atmosphere–forest fire modelling, exploring the fundamental dynamical behaviour of both the fire itself and its associated smoke plume; generation and evolution of coherent vortices in rotating, stratified turbulence.
